Hyppää sisältöön
    • Suomeksi
    • På svenska
    • In English
  • Suomi
  • Svenska
  • English
  • Kirjaudu
Hakuohjeet
JavaScript is disabled for your browser. Some features of this site may not work without it.
Näytä viite 
  •   Ammattikorkeakoulut
  • Centria-ammattikorkeakoulu
  • Opinnäytetyöt (Avoin kokoelma)
  • Näytä viite
  •   Ammattikorkeakoulut
  • Centria-ammattikorkeakoulu
  • Opinnäytetyöt (Avoin kokoelma)
  • Näytä viite

Countries data visualization system : Exploring country data through interactive visualizations

Tidu, Marco (2023)

 
Avaa tiedosto
Tidu_Marco.pdf (6.683Mt)
Lataukset: 


Tidu, Marco
2023
All rights reserved. This publication is copyrighted. You may download, display and print it for Your own personal use. Commercial use is prohibited.
Näytä kaikki kuvailutiedot
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-2023061323669
Tiivistelmä
This project aimed to develop a web application that provides users with information about countries worldwide. The application utilizes the REST Countries APIi to fetch and display country data, in- cluding population, area, and borders. The project's main objectives were to create an user-friendly interface with data visualization tools, implement state management, and ensure application respon- siveness across different devices.

The development process involved using Reactii for the frontend, Reduxiii for state management, Ex- press.jsiv and Node.jsv for the backend side and Tailwindvi and Flowbitevii for custom styling. Data vis- ualization tools like tables, graphs, and live calculations were implemented to aid users in understand- ing the information using Chart.jsviii as visualization library. The project also incorporated best prac- tices for state management and responsive design to provide a smooth and efficient user experience.

The project's outcome was a functional and interactive web application that achieved the objectives set out in the beginning. The application allows users to search for specific countries, view country data, and compare countries based on different criteria. The project's significance lies in its contribu- tion to making information about countries more accessible and easily digestible for users. The skills gained during the project, including proficiency in React, Redux, Express, Node and Tailwind, are valuable for building dynamic and responsive web applications.
Kokoelmat
  • Opinnäytetyöt (Avoin kokoelma)
Ammattikorkeakoulujen opinnäytetyöt ja julkaisut
Yhteydenotto | Tietoa käyttöoikeuksista | Tietosuojailmoitus | Saavutettavuusseloste
 

Selaa kokoelmaa

NimekkeetTekijätJulkaisuajatKoulutusalatAsiasanatUusimmatKokoelmat

Henkilökunnalle

Ammattikorkeakoulujen opinnäytetyöt ja julkaisut
Yhteydenotto | Tietoa käyttöoikeuksista | Tietosuojailmoitus | Saavutettavuusseloste